Style, Elegance And Class At The Sixth Kakira Nile Polo Tournament

The sixth Kakira Nile Polo tournament held last weekend was the place to be for charitable celebrities and the well-heeled socialites who came to watch some action and donate to a cause that benefits the disadvantaged children in Uganda.
With the Johnnie Walker Platinum Label as the lead sponsor, the classy event brought to Uganda the thrilling combination of polo, style and elegance, fashion and fun.
“I love polo and have seen many matches worldwide. Nothing however compares to the tournament we hold in Kakira for its unique location, format, Ugandan hospitality and fun,” Kakira Nile Polo Club Chairman Nitin Madhvani said.
At the end of the two-day event, Shell V-Power triumphed over Airtel to win Nile Cup and Johnnie Walker beat Barclays to win the big trophy of the day, the Madhvani Cup.
Elizabeth Bagaya, the Princess Royal of Tooro Kingdom was the guest of honour of the event. She was impressed by the sportsmanship exhibited by the players and fashion off-field, considering that she is a former international model.
One of the highlights was the Saturday night Platinum Label black-tie dinner dance that also served as a fundraiser to benefit disadvantaged Ugandan children.
The event is now firmly placed as one of the major events on the annual social calendar.
